RECREATIONAL ACTIVITY SUPERVISOR Date: Mar 5, 2024 Req ID: 37952 Location: Wrightsville - Wrightsville Un, AR, US, 72183 Category: DEPARTMENT OF CORRECTION Anticipated Starting Salary: $32,405.00 Position Number: 22085347 County: Pulaski Posting End Date: 3/19/2024 Anticipated Starting Salary: $32,405.00 Location: Wrightsville Unit - Wrightsville The mission of the Department of Corrections is to be a public safety resource for Arkansas families by providing professional management solutions and evidence-based rehabilitative initiatives for offenders. All DOC positions are designated as Safety Sensitive Positions and are subject to random drug testing pursuant to the Secretarial Directive governing Personnel Drug Testing. Medical marijuana usage, as defined in Amendment 93 of the Arkansas Constitution, prohibits Personnel in a Safety-Sensitive Position from the use of medical marijuana even if they are qualifying patient under the amendment and/or hold a registry identification card. Department Personnel are prohibited from the use or possession of a medicinal marijuana card pursuant to this policy and state law. Position InformationClass Code: M065CGrade: GS05FLSA Status: NON-EXEMPTSalary Range: $32,405.00 - $46,987.00SummaryThe Recreational Activity Supervisor is responsible for directing the recreation staff and residents engaged in recreational activities. This position is governed by state and federal laws and agency/institution policy.FunctionsLeads and provides guidance to subordinate staff by establishing work plans, timeframes, and/or deadlines, staff assignments, and resolving difficult or complex problems to ensure accurate and effective application of policies, rules, or precedents. Supervises, plans, and organizes recreational activities by reserving vehicles and acquiring tickets for events, determining amount of staff needed, and posting schedules of activities. Develops and/or modifies programs or games, as necessary, to permit participation by disabled and/or restricted residents, sets up recreational equipment for needed activities, and recruits, trains, coordinates, and monitors volunteers for activities. Teaches physical education classes to residents, and trains, coaches, and organizes special Olympic games. Monitors and documents resident's behavior and progress during recreational activities. Inventories and checks recreational equipment to ensure proper working order, and maintains recreation rooms by spot cleaning and securing equipment. Drives various vehicles to transport residents to and from recreational activities, including ballgames, restaurants, picnics, and other outings. Performs other duties as assigned.DimensionsNoneKnowledge, Skills and AbilitiesKnowledge of principles, practices, and operations of recreational activity programs. Knowledge of activity therapy and behavior modification. Ability to plan, organize, and direct the work of others. Ability to prepare, present, and review oral and written information and reports. Ability to participate and direct recreational activities. Ability to plan, organize, and monitor the effectiveness of recreational activity programs. Ability to communicate orally and in writing.Minimum QualificationsThe formal education equivalent of a bachelor's degree in social work, psychology, physical education, or a related field.
